säsongsfenomen
Säsongsfenomen refers to a phenomenon that occurs or changes with the seasons. These are natural occurrences that are directly influenced by the Earth's annual orbit around the sun and its axial tilt. The most obvious examples are biological, such as the blooming of flowers in spring, the shedding of leaves from deciduous trees in autumn, or the hibernation of animals during winter. Weather patterns are also strong seasonal phenomena, with distinct temperature, precipitation, and daylight variations across different times of the year in many regions.
